Crawlspace foundation repair services focus on addressing issues beneath a building’s main structure, specifically within the crawlspace area. This work typically involves inspecting the existing foundation, identifying signs of damage or instability, and implementing solutions such as underpinning, pier installation, or reinforcement of existing supports. The goal is to stabilize the foundation, prevent further deterioration, and ensure the overall safety and integrity of the property. Repair contractors may also address moisture problems, mold growth, or pest infestations that often accompany crawlspace issues, contributing to a healthier indoor environment.

Many problems that crawlspace foundation repair services help resolve are related to shifting or settling foundations, which can cause uneven flooring, cracks in walls, or misaligned doors and windows. In some cases, the soil beneath the foundation may have shifted or eroded, leading to instability. Excess moisture or poor drainage can weaken the foundation’s support system over time, resulting in sagging or bowing supports. Repair specialists work to correct these issues by restoring proper support and preventing further movement, which can help avoid costly structural repairs in the future.

Properties that typically utilize crawlspace foundation repair services include older homes, especially those built on uneven or poorly compacted soil, as well as newer constructions that experience settlement issues. Commercial buildings, multi-family units, and residential homes with accessible crawlspaces are also common candidates for these repairs. The extent of the work varies based on the severity of the foundation problems, but the primary aim remains to restore stability, prevent further damage, and improve overall property safety.

Foundation Repair Cost - The typical cost for crawlspace foundation repair services ranges from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. For example, minor repairs may be closer to $2,000, while extensive underpinning can reach higher amounts.

Repair Method Expenses - Costs vary based on the repair approach, with pier and beam repairs averaging between $1,500 and $4,500. More complex solutions like underpinning can increase costs to $6,000 or more, depending on the foundation’s condition.

Material and Labor Costs - Material expenses for foundation repairs generally fall between $1,000 and $3,500, with labor costs making up the remaining amount. These prices can fluctuate based on local contractor rates and the size of the crawlspace.

What are common sign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ven floors, sagging or cracked walls, musty odors, and visible mold or moisture in the crawlspace area.

How can crawlspace foundation problems affect a home? Foundation issues can lead to structural instability, increased energy costs, and potential damage to flooring and walls above the crawlspace.

What repair options are available for crawlspace foundations? Local service providers may offer solutions such as pier and beam repairs, underpinning, or foundation stabilization to address specific issues.
